Share of children who are underweight vs. share in extreme poverty in Armenia
Armenia: Share of children who are underweight vs. share in extreme poverty was 2.6% in 2016. ▲ Rising
Share of children who are underweight vs. share in extreme poverty in Armenia, 1998–2016
Source: Joint child Malnutrition Estimates (JME) - UNICEF, WHO, and World Bank (2026) – processed by Our World in Data. Measured in % of children under 5.
Analysis
Armenia recorded 2.6% for share of children who are underweight vs. share in extreme poverty in 2016. That is the lowest value across all 5 years on record.
The figure is down 38.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, share of children who are underweight vs. share in extreme poverty in Armenia peaked at 5.3% in 2010 and was at its lowest, 2.6%, in 2000.
That places Armenia 82nd out of 96 countries with data for 2016, putting it in the bottom quarter.

About this data
Underweight children are those less than 5 years old, whose weight for age is more than two standard deviations below the median for the international reference population. Extreme poverty is defined as living below the International Poverty Line of $3 per day.
